Sergio Massa will announce this week the name of the Deputy Minister of Economy

The Minister of Economy, Sergio Massa, will define this week the name of his deputy minister, with which he would finally complete his team and exercise a decisive task to appease the markets. According to the information that emerged, the name of the economist Gabriel Rubinstein for the position regained strength in the last hours. Two other economists who would have been polled by Massa were Martín Rapetti and Diego Bossio, the directors of the consulting firm Equilibra. The vice minister’s job will be to impose a macroeconomic vision on the program proposed by the portfolio, whose main objective is now to avoid a devaluation and a breakaway from inflation, with the idea of reaching the 2023 elections as well as possible.In addition, adding dollars to the reserves of the Central Bank is a critical objective of the very short term and design a financing scheme in pesos. For his part, before the possible political decision, Rubinstein said that “the urgent and important thing in Argentina is to end the fiscal imbalance, improve internal and external credibility (important from the political point of view) to strengthen reserves and maintain a ‘responsible indebtedness'”.

“Under these conditions, inflation could begin to stabilize at reasonable levels. Otherwise, hyperinflationary risk will continue to knock on the door, and increasingly stronger,” the economist concluded on his social networks.
